We are seeking an enthusiastic and skilled DT Technician to join our client's successful Design & Technology department. The ideal candidate will support teachers and students across a range of DT disciplines, including Product Design, Resistant Materials, Graphics, and Food Technology.

Key Responsibilities

  • Prepare, maintain, and organise materials, tools, and equipment for practical lessons

  • Support teachers during practical sessions and provide technical guidance to students

  • Ensure all machinery and equipment are maintained safely and in accordance with regulations

  • Manage stock levels, order resources, and keep the prep areas well-organised

  • Produce prototypes, demonstration models, and teaching aids as required

  • Promote and maintain high health & safety standards throughout the department

  • Support whole-school events, extracurricular activities, and project work where needed

The Successful Candidate Will Have:

  • Practical experience with workshop machinery and tools (e.g., saws, sanders, 3D printers, laser cutters)

  • A good understanding of health & safety in a workshop/school environment

  • Strong organisational skills and the ability to manage multiple tasks

  • A proactive, flexible, and hands-on approach

  • Good communication skills and an ability to work as part of a team

  • (Desirable) A relevant qualification or experience in DT, engineering, or a related technical field

  • (Desirable) Experience working in education, though full training can be provided
